Q1.
By expanding the expressions, verify that all three expressions are equivalent. If x = 8 and y = 3, find the area of the shaded region.
Answer
| Method | Expression | Expanded |
|---|---|---|
| Anusha | x² – xy | x² – xy |
| Vaishnavi | x(x + 2y) – 3xy | x² + 2xy – 3xy = x² – xy |
| Aditya | 2x((x – y)⁄2) | x(x – y) = x² – xy |
All three reduce to x² – xy, so they are equivalent.
At x = 8, y = 3:
x² – xy = 64 – 24 = 40 square units
Check with Vaishnavi: 8 × 14 – 3 × 24 = 112 – 72 = 40 ✓
Check with Aditya: 8 × 5 = 40 ✓
